Apprentice Diesel Fitter Courses in Gympie

An Apprentice Diesel Fitter assembles machinery parts and conducts servicing under guidance, requiring teamwork, communication, and attention to detail.

In Australia, a full time Apprentice Diesel Fitter generally earns $960 per week ($49,920 annual salary) before tax. This is a median figure for full-time employees and should be considered a guide only. As you gain more experience you can expect a potentially higher salary than people who are new to the industry.

The number of people working in this industry has decreased over the last five years. There are currently 62,200 people employed as a Diesel Fitter in Australia and many of them are completing an apprenticeship. Apprentice Diesel Fitters may find work across all regions of Australia.

Source: Australian Government Labour Market Insights

If you’re planning to work as an Apprentice Diesel Fitter, consider enrolling in a Certificate II in Automotive Servicing Technology. This course covers a range of topics including workplace safety, tools and equipment and servicing operations. A Certificate II in Automotive Underbody Technology or a Certificate III in Automotive Diesel Engine Technology may also be appropriate.

If you're interested in pursuing a career as an Apprentice Diesel Fitter, Gympie offers a solid selection of courses to kickstart your journey in the automotive sector. With 5 tailored Apprentice Diesel Fitter courses in Gympie, you can find the right fit for your career goals. For beginners with little to no prior experience, courses such as the Certificate III in Heavy Commercial Vehicle Mechanical Technology, Certificate III in Automotive Diesel Engine Technology, and Certificate II in Automotive Underbody Technology are excellent starting points.

In Gympie, you have reputable training providers such as TAFE Queensland and IAT4M, the latter offering the Certificate II in Automotive Underbody Technology, ensuring you receive quality training recognised by industry standards. These organisations are focused on providing practical skills and knowledge that will help you excel in various job roles related to diesel fitting, including both trades and automotive fields.
